Asian Grilled Pork

4 cloves garlic, minced
2 tablespoons finely chopped fresh lemongrass
2 shallots, finely chopped
1/4 cup packed light brown sugar
3 tablespoons fish sauce
2 tablespoons soy sauce
2 tablespoons vegetable oil, plus more for brushing
Kosher salt and freshly ground pepper
4 Pork Chops of choice

Mix all the above ingrediants, and use to marinade your favorite type of pork chops, loin, or tendloin. I usually marinade for 4 hours or so.

Grill on low heat, so the marinade doesn't burn. I perfer to use my Traeger, on 300 degrees for about 45 minutes, depending on size and cut of meat. Inspired by foodnetwork.com.
